RCAA participates in Christmas in the Park

This is the second year for River City Art Association to decorate a shelter in Deming Park.

Thanks to members Don Turner for his Baby Jesus in the Manger portrait, Deb Anderson for the Wise Men landscape, and Richard and Edith Acton for creating the Santa sleigh and Angel. Mike Bender added Rudolph and Christmas wreaths to this year’s display.

The construction crew this year included Todd Stokes, Mike Bender, Sheila Ter Meer, Don Turner, and Edith and Richard Acton.
